Pink Panther, Tuesday 12th April 2005
A total of 26 ladies played in the Pink Panther which took place alongside the medal.
The Pink Panther is a strokeplay competition with each player's ball being marked with a pink dot and the person with the lowest nett score completing the course with their original ball is the winner.

Kim Wingrove Trophy, Sunday 10th April 2005
On the 10th April 2005 twelve players took part in the Kim Wingrove Cup. Kim was a 7 day lady and she died in June 2003. She had a wicked sense of humour, hence the format of the Chapman 2 ball. Both players tee off and then they swap over with their playing partner for their next shots. After that they choose the better ball and alternate shots are played until the hole is completed.
